General Information

Oshki-Wenjack is located in Thunder Bay, Ontario. They work closely with Nishnawbe Aski Nation communities and partner with several post-secondary institutions to deliver their programming. For more information about Oshki-Wenjack’s programs and how to apply, visit Program Directory.

Elders Program

The Elders Program on campus offers a variety of services to students, including counselling and referral services, cultural awareness, and traditional teachings.

Housing

Oshki-Wenjack does not provide on campus housing. However, Sibley Hall Residences at Confederation College offer accommodations for Oshki-Wenjack students. For questions about housing options, please reach out to Oshki-Wenjack directly. 

Campus Accessibility

Oshki-Wenjack’s campus is centrally located in the downtown south core of Thunder Bay, close to bus transportation, and is accessible to people with disabilities. Oshki-Wenjack offers a campus map you can explore on their website.

Accessibility

Thunder Bay Transit offers accessible transit with features such as low floors, kneeling capabilities, priority seating, and automated call stop announcements. Thunder Bay Transit offers a Support Person Pass, which allows users of the transit system who require a support person to have this person travel with them at no additional cost.

Thunder Bay Transit offers Lift+ which is a door-to-door specialized transit system, designed for persons with disabilities who are unable to use the conventional transit system. More information about Lift+ and the eligibility guidelines and application is provided on their website.
